"Malware Masters Exploit Blogger Platform in Devastating Cyber Attack Wave"
Cybersecurity researchers have uncovered a sophisticated multi-stage malware delivery attack chain that leverages social engineering tactics and compromised Blogger pages to disseminate an information stealer dubbed PureLogs. Dubbed VEIL#DROP by Securonix, the threat actors behind this campaign have been suspected to be orchestrating a large-scale cyber assault, targeting unsuspecting users.
**Key Developments**
The VEIL#DROP campaign is characterized by its use of Blogger, a popular blogging platform, as a conduit for malware distribution. Threat actors create malicious Blogger pages designed to appear legitimate, hosting obfuscated JavaScript code that redirects victims to a secondary payload hosting site. Upon execution, the PureLogs information stealer is deployed, enabling attackers to siphon sensitive information, including login credentials and other personal data. Securonix researchers have observed a significant spike in VEIL#DROP activity, indicating a potentially widespread threat.
